Khatundi
Khatundi is a village located in Ketugram I subdivision of Barddhaman district in West Bengal, India. It is situated 19.1km away from sub-district headquarter Kandara. Barddhaman is the district headquarter of Khatundi village. As per 2009 stats, Pandugram is the gram panchayat of Khatundi village.

About Khatundi
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Khatundi is 319228. The village spans a total geographical area of 316.64 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 713519. Katwa is nearest town to Khatundi village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 42km away.

Population of Khatundi
Below is a concise population overview of Khatundi as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 2,671 | 1,398 | 1,273 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 270 | 140 | 130 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 1,457 | 775 | 682 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 3 | 3 | N/A |
Literate Population | 1,479 | 837 | 642 |
Illiterate Population | 1,192 | 561 | 631 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Khatundi village:
- The total population of Khatundi village is around 2,671, including approximately 1,398 males and 1,273 females, with a sex ratio of 910 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 270 children aged 0–6 years in Khatundi village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Khatundi village has 1,457 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 3 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Khatundi village is about 55.37%, with male literacy at 59.87% and female literacy at 50.43%.
- There are around 595 households in Khatundi village.
Connectivity of Khatundi
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Khatundi. As per the 2011 stats, Khatundi had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within village |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
